使用来自不同实体的属性作为视图中的属性

2020-09-05 08:01发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)尊敬的Sappies, 我在S...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


尊敬的Sappies,

我在SAP网关中定义了两个实体(和相应的实体集),例如:

实体集:PERSONSet

 ID | 名| 姓| 市
 --- | ------------ || ----------- | ----------------
 1 | 约翰| 美国能源部 纽约
 2 | 克里斯| 派克 华盛顿特区。

 ---

 实体集:MEETINGSet

 ID | 人1 | 人2 | 市
 --- | --------- | --------- || ----------
 1 |  1 |  2 | 圣地亚哥
 2 |  2 |  1 | 佛罗里达州

现在,我想像这样在SAPUI5表中显示所有会议:

 <表项目=" {/MEETINGSet}">
     <列>
         <栏目>
             <标题>
                 
             
             
<栏目> <标题>
<栏目> <标题>
<项目> <单元格> />

尽管我的表项来自/MEETINGSet,但如何访问其他表的属性?

我想知道类似的事情

 text =" {
     路径:"/img/PERSONSet"
     参数:???
 }" 

但是不幸的是,我被困住了。

谢谢您的帮助!

2条回答
compass1988
2020-09-05 09:05 .采纳回答

弗洛里安你好,

您可以通过Formatter实现此目的->您必须根据参数读取第二个模型。

http://www.sapui5tutors.com/2016/ 07/formatters-and-inline-expressions.html

您还可以使用Odata关联并将数据作为深度结构发送。

另一种方法是通过JS创建本地json模型,并将您的2个模型合并为一个,在每次会议中,您都有一组人员。

Saad

一周热门 更多>